Commercial Gas Line Repair in Columbus, OH
Commercial gas line repair services involve diagnosing and fixing issues with the natural gas or propane lines that supply appliances and equipment in residential properties. These projects can include repairing leaks, replacing damaged piping, or upgrading existing lines to meet safety standards. Property owners typically seek this service when experiencing irregular gas flow, hearing hissing sounds, or noticing the smell of gas, as well as during routine inspections or renovations that require modifications to the gas line system.
Before requesting gas line repair, property owners should understand the scope of the work needed and any potential safety considerations. It is important to identify the specific appliances or areas affected, as well as any recent changes or damages that might have impacted the gas lines. Clear communication about the location of the lines, the type of gas used, and the history of previous repairs can help ensure the project proceeds smoothly and safely.

Commercial Gas Line Repair Questions
What are signs of a damaged gas line? Signs include a sulfur smell, hissing sounds, or a pilot light that won't stay lit.
Is it safe to attempt gas line repairs myself? No, gas line repairs should be performed by trained professionals to ensure safety and compliance.
What types of gas line issues require repair? Common issues include leaks, corrosion, or damaged fittings that affect gas flow and safety.
